The Power of Continuous Learning in Expanding Your Freelance Services
In today's rapidly evolving digital landscape, marketplaces like Upwork, Fiverr, and Freelancer have become essential platforms for freelancers to showcase their skills, find clients, and grow their businesses. However, standing out on these competitive platforms requires more than just a set of initial skills; it demands a commitment to continuous learning.
Why Continuous Learning Matters
Continuous learning is crucial in expanding your freelance services because the gig economy is dynamic and ever-changing. New tools, technologies, and trends emerge constantly, and staying updated ensures you remain relevant and competitive. For instance, as remote work becomes more prevalent, proficiency with project management tools like Trello or Asana can significantly enhance your offerings on platforms such as Upwork.
Practical Applications and Best Practices
To harness the power of continuous learning, start by setting specific goals related to your freelance services. For example, if you specialize in graphic design, focus on mastering Adobe XD for user interface design or learning about motion graphics software like After Effects. These skills can open new avenues for projects and clients.

Engage in peer learning through online forums and communities related to your niche. Platforms like Reddit have subreddits dedicated to freelancers where you can share knowledge, ask for advice, and learn from others' experiences. This not only keeps you informed but also builds a supportive network of professionals.
Common Mistakes and How to Avoid Them
A common pitfall is overextending oneself by trying to learn too many skills simultaneously. Instead, focus on one or two key areas at a time until you become proficient before moving on to the next. This approach ensures that your learning curve remains manageable and effective.
Another mistake is ignoring industry changes. It's easy to get complacent in a familiar niche, but failing to adapt can lead to losing clients who are looking for updated services. Regularly review trends within your field through industry publications or social media groups to stay informed.
Conclusion
Continuous learning is not just an option; it’s essential for success as a freelancer on platforms like Upwork, Fiverr, and Freelancer. By staying abreast of new tools, technologies, and trends, you can expand your service offerings, attract more clients, and grow your business sustainably. Embrace the challenge of continuous learning, and watch your freelance career flourish.
